Historical Events on July 26

Liberia declares independence, July 26, 1847 – The West African nation of Liberia proclaims its independence from the American Colonization Society’s governance

Americans with Disabilities Act signed, July 26, 1990 – U.S. President George H. W. Bush enacts landmark civil rights law prohibiting discrimination based on disability

Moncada Barracks attack, July 26, 1953 – Fidel Castro leads an attack on the Moncada army barracks in Cuba, a key event that helps spark the Cuban Revolution
